Transaction 21d0784322d56558de5500ff07a40dda6798883d87bb024b8a678b46c192bb1e

1 Input
2 Outputs
  • 21d0784322d56558de5500ff07a40dda6798883d87bb024b8a678b46c192bb1e:0
  • value  967000
    address  35EFAkTN62MMGkopirRPDd53hkUEZAwuuM
  • 21d0784322d56558de5500ff07a40dda6798883d87bb024b8a678b46c192bb1e:1
  • value  813917595
    address  bc1q6gus23hqk8tw5m2qc7rseycvgqepx66w2kdd9u